Step into this exquisite family home, nestled within the prestigious outskirts of Coxhoe Village. Built in 2021, it has undergone significant upgrades, offering impressive accommodation and refinement.

On the ground floor, a welcoming entrance hall leads to a spacious reception room and a convenient WC. The well-appointed kitchen dining room is perfect for culinary enthusiasts and family meals.

Ascend to the first floor to find a versatile reception room or fourth double bedroom, along with a generously proportioned double bedroom and a tastefully designed family bathroom/WC.

On the second floor, a second double bedroom awaits, alongside the opulent master bedroom featuring a Jack and Jill en-suite shower room connecting to the second double bedroom.

Outside, an open-plan lawned garden to the front and side enhances the kerb appeal, while an enclosed landscaped garden to the side offers a serene retreat with paved and gravelled patio areas, botanical shrubs, and flowerbeds, perfect for relaxation and entertaining. Parking is catered for via two parking spaces.

Coxhoe, nestled in County Durham, England, offers a harmonious blend of rural charm and modern comforts just 6 miles south of Durham city center. Its serene landscapes and tight-knit community attract those seeking a slower pace of life without sacrificing urban amenities. Despite its rustic feel, Coxhoe boasts excellent road connectivity via the A177 and A688, making commuting easy. Despite its size, the village provides essential amenities, enhancing residents' quality of life.
